Summary Statement of Deficiencies D0000 The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) conducted an unannounced CLIA Recertification survey at the Laboratorio Clnico Los Puertos-Magnolia on August 5, 2026. The laboratory was surveyed under 42 CFR part 493 CLIA Requirements. The following standard level deficiencies were found during the unannounced routine CLIA recertification survey ending on August 5, 2026. D5215 EVALUATION OF PROFICIENCY TESTING PERFORMANCE CFR(s): 493.1236(b)(2) The laboratory must verify the accuracy of any analyte, specialty or subspecialty assigned a proficiency testing score that does not reflect laboratory test performance (that is, when the proficiency testing program does not obtain the agreement required for scoring as specified in subpart I of this part, or the laboratory receives a zero score for nonparticipation, or late return or results). This STANDARD is not met as evidenced by: Based on review of Puerto Rico Proficiency Testing Service Program (PRPTSP) scores (years 2025 - 2026), Certification and Survey Provider Enhanced Reports (CASPER Report 0155D) scores, hematology Proficiency Testing (PT) scores (year 2025) and laboratory testing personnel interview on August 5, 2026, at 10:02 A.M.; the laboratory failed to evaluate the accuracy of testing in the hematology specialty when the laboratory received an artificially score of 100 percent from the PT provider. The laboratory processed and reported 331 patient samples from November 2025 through June, 2026. The findings include: 1. The CASPER Report 0155D scores were review on August 4, 2026 at 3:00 PM, and show that the laboratory received 100 percent score in the third event of hematology in the year 2025. 2. PRPTSP were reviewed from February 2025 through June 2026. 3. Review of the hematology PT scores for the third testing event in 2025 showed that the PT provider assigned an artificial score of 100 percent. The results were not evaluated. 4. During interview On August 5, 2026, at 10:02 A.M.; with the laboratory testing personnel, the accuracy of Statement of Deficiencies (X1) Provider/Supplier/CLIA Identification Number (X3) Date Survey Completed Name of Provider or Supplier Street Address, City, State -- 1 of 2 -- the excused hematology specialty (Complete Blood Count - (CBC) and White Blood Cell (WBC) 5 Parameters) was required. The laboratory testing personnel stated that no procedure for accuracy evaluation was performed. 5. The testing personnel also stated on August 5, 2026, at 10:02 A.M.; that no written procedure was developed by the laboratory to evaluated the accuracy of test not evaluated by the PT provider. 6. From November 2025 through June, 2026, the laboratory processed and reported 331 patient samples.
